Earnhardt-Ganassi Racing PARKS The 8 Car
FanIQ Blog — It was first reported on Tuesday, but now it is all over the NASCAR airwaves.  The number 8, made famous by Dale Earnhardt Jr. has been parked by Earnhardt-Ganassi Racing, pending sponsorship. The sponsorship woes have hit more than one team this year, and this is the second of the Ganassi cars parked in less than a year.  Dario Franchitti was in the 40 car last year when sponsorship dried up. Aric was expecting the news, and really has nothing else planned, anticipating "something" will come together shortly. Us NASCAR fans ...
